Alex Ketzko

Alexander Gregorieff Ketzko (November 19, 1919 – December 23, 1944) was an American football player. A native of Chicago, he moved with his family to Mattawan, Michigan as a boy. He played college football for Michigan State College (later known as Michigan State University) in 1938 and 1939. In July 1940, he signed to play professional football for the Paterson Panthers of the American Professional Football Association. He also played in the National Football League as a tackle for the Detroit Lions, appearing in nine games during his rookie year of 1943. After the 1943 season, he was inducted into the United States Army. He was killed in action in France in December 1944 at age 25.
